A recent example of this dedication took place during our City Council meeting this past Monday evening. The Council voted on three ordinances necessary for establishing a Tax Increment Financing (TIF) District at the Chestnut Court Shopping Center. After years of working toward a solution to the growing vacancies in the center, we are now approaching a possible solution that will see the center return to the vibrancy once seen back in the 1990’s. The establishment of a TIF District is but one step in the process. While a final development agreement with the property owner is still to come, Monday’s vote represented a critical step forward in the process.
